Protein data for RUVX_BACSU:

Description:
Putative Holliday junction resolvase (EC 3.1.-.-).

Molecular weight: 15210

Comments:
-!- FUNCTION: Could be a nuclease that resolves Holliday junction
intermediates in genetic recombination.
-!- SUBCELLULAR LOCATION: Cytoplasm (Potential).
-!- SIMILARITY: Belongs to the yqgF HJR family.
